

New Nature and Cause of Injury Code for COVID-19 Claims Reporting
The Workers Compensation Insurance Organizations (WCIO) has updated the Injury Description Tables that are used by International Association of Industrial Accident Boards and Commissions (IAIABC) to reflect specific coding in response to the corona virus (COVID-19). The new cause of injury code 83 (Pandemic) and new nature of injury code 83 (COVID-19) are being adopted by DWC. The WCIS reporting system has been modified to accept the new nature and cause of injury codes for COVID-19 claims.
To report COVID-19 claims, please use the new code 83 (COVID-19) for FROI DN 35 Nature of Injury Code and the new code 83 (Pandemic) for FROI DN37 Cause of Injury Code.
